What is the Medical Records Request Form?
The Medical Records Request Form is a critical document in legal settings, designed to ensure the smooth retrieval of medical records necessary for legal proceedings. This form plays a significant role in court cases, allowing attorneys to obtain essential documentation that can support their arguments and represent their clients effectively. The form includes key information such as attorney details, case specifics, and the medical records being requested.
Obtaining medical records is vital in legal cases, as they can provide evidence that may significantly impact the outcome. By using this legal records request form, attorneys can streamline their communication with healthcare providers and enhance the efficiency of their case preparations.

Who Needs the Medical Records Request Form?
The Medical Records Request Form is primarily utilized by professionals involved in legal cases. Attorneys, for instance, need this form to gather the necessary documents to support their arguments during court proceedings. Additionally, adjusters may use this form to obtain medical records relevant to claims processing.
Various scenarios necessitate the use of this form, especially during court cases and insurance claims. Eligibility criteria for signing the form might vary, but typically, only authorized personnel such as attorneys are required to sign for official requests.

Are there any fees associated with requesting medical records?
Typically, fees may apply for obtaining copies of medical records. It's advisable to check with the healthcare provider or legal entity for specific costs associated with accessing records.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include leaving required fields blank, incorrect spelling of names, and failing to include all necessary information about the medical and legal case.
How long does it take to process the Medical Records Request?
Processing times can vary depending on the healthcare provider's policies and the complexity of the records requested. It is best to inquire directly for estimated timeframes.
Do I need my attorney's signature on the form?
Yes, the Medical Records Request Form typically requires the signature of the attorney to validate the request as part of the legal process.
